    Quote from Moronicizer
    I think UB tezz is way better than mono blue. It's -1 lets you kill people in 2-3 turns once you have them locked whereas U tezz requires you to ultimate and costs 1 more mana. I don't think the search is really much better than UB's +1 because you are probably only playing tezz when you already have your pieces out. UB's ultimate is also a pretty decent way to get some extra lifegain if you are up against a burn deck. If anything, UB tezz is so good, I would try to find more cards that use black to justify running more black in the manabase. Inquistion of kozilek might be worthwhile as it lets you see their hand early on and take out the early threats while also just being fantastic vs combo decks in general. Could even run nihil spellbomb as recurrable graveyard removal where relic is 1-time use and grafdigger just seems the worst of the 3. I would also probably try to run some man-lands to help kill people once you have them locked. Has anybody considered using psychic spiral as a possible wincon? I haven't playtested the deck, so i'm not sure how consistently you can put cards into your own graveyard, but it seems like it could be worth testing.
